The Asia-Pacific Digital Diagnostics Market was valued at USD 471.25 million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 1,480.25 million by 2030, registering a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 21.02% over the forecast period. This growth can be attributed to factors such as increased awareness of digital pathology and its benefits, rising disposable income, collaborative initiatives by healthcare organizations, and efforts by industry players to promote the use of digital pathology for enhancing the accuracy of cancer diagnostics in the region.

Key Market Drivers

Rising Adoption of Telemedicine and Remote Patient Monitoring

The increasing adoption of telemedicine and remote patient monitoring (RPM) across the Asia-Pacific region is a key growth driver for the digital diagnostics market. As healthcare costs rise, and access to medical services remains limited in rural areas, digital diagnostic tools offer solutions that enable healthcare providers to diagnose, monitor, and manage patient conditions remotely. Devices like wearable technologies, sensors, and mobile health applications allow clinicians to access real-time health data, facilitating timely diagnoses and interventions. The COVID-19 pandemic has accelerated the shift to telemedicine, and the demand for remote consultations and diagnostics is expected to continue post-pandemic, further enhancing healthcare delivery in the region. This growth is supported by advancements in mobile technology, cloud computing, and artificial intelligence, offering greater accessibility, convenience, and optimized healthcare efficiency.

Key Market Challenges

Data Privacy and Security Concerns

A major challenge facing the growth of the digital diagnostics market in Asia-Pacific is concerns surrounding data privacy and security. The collection and storage of sensitive patient information via digital health tools heighten the risk of cyberattacks, data breaches, and misuse of health data. Several countries in the region lack standardized regulations and frameworks to address these concerns effectively. The absence of strong data security measures creates hesitation among both healthcare providers and patients regarding the adoption of digital diagnostic technologies. Furthermore, the challenge of complying with varying data protection laws across different countries in the region adds complexity for companies operating in the digital diagnostics sector.

Key Market Trends

Integration of Wearable Health Devices

Wearable health devices, including fitness trackers, smartwatches, and health monitoring patches, are rapidly gaining traction in the Asia-Pacific region. These devices continuously collect data on vital health parameters, such as heart rate, blood oxygen levels, sleep patterns, and physical activity, which can be analyzed to monitor chronic diseases and detect early warning signs of medical conditions. With the increasing focus on preventive healthcare and growing adoption of personal health monitoring, the integration of wearable devices into digital diagnostics is on the rise. These devices empower patients with greater control over their health, while enabling healthcare providers to track patient progress and intervene when necessary. Advancements in technology have made these wearables more sophisticated, enhancing their capabilities for real-time diagnostics and health management.
